On Mon, 2 Feb 1998, Martin von Loewis wrote:
> > Is there any point to using threaded FS drivers? or threaded physical > > hardware drivers? > > The Linux file system drivers have been threaded for ages. Multiple > processes can access different files in an overlapping fashion; while > one process is waiting for a request to complete, the file system might > already look into the request of another process. > > There are a few places where concurrent access is not desirable, Linux > supports locks on the inode level and on the superblock level for > these cases.
Actually - I was thinking of actual asynchronous FS-management... Where, say, a kernel thread was being used to manage the device rather than the local process... (as it is currently :)
Though, thinking about this, there's really not a lot of point to it unless you have a multi-CPU system and want to dedicate one CPU (or more) to filesystem-management/caching or the like. (or other special purpose such as 3D graphics layer on a real accelerated card - where kernel-thread is a necessity not an option [IRQ's (+DMA) are required] :)
In other words - only a special case thingy... Okay ;)
